site stats

How to store negative numbers in c

WebNov 4, 2024 · The output of the above c program; as follows: Please Enter the Size of an Array : 5 Please Enter the Array Elements 1 2 -3 4 -5 Total Number of Positive Numbers in … WebNegative numbers are stored as 2's complement of its positive part. By the way after changing 0 to 1 and vice versa you dont get the 2's complement but the 1's complement, …

Negative numbers in C

WebFeb 26, 2024 · By default, integers in C++ are signed, which means the number’s sign is stored as part of the number. Therefore, a signed integer can hold both positive and … WebSep 15, 2024 · If you know that your variable never needs to hold a negative number, you can use the unsigned types Byte, UShort, UInteger, and ULong. Each of these data types can hold a positive integer twice as large as its corresponding signed … derrick henry play for https://obandanceacademy.com

Storage of integer and character values in C - GeeksforGeeks

WebApr 4, 2024 · A 1-byte unsigned integer has a range of 0 to 255. Compare this to the 1-byte signed integer range of -128 to 127. Both can store 256 different values, but signed integers use half of their range for negative numbers, whereas unsigned integers can store positive numbers that are twice as large. WebOct 31, 2014 · In a two's complement system, you negate a value by inverting the bits and adding 1. To get from 5 to -5, you'd do: 5 == 0101 => 1010 + 1 == 1011 == -5 To go from … WebAug 1, 2024 · Floating point data types are always signed (can hold positive and negative values). Here are some definitions of floating point variables: float fValue; double dValue; long double ldValue; When using floating point literals, always include at least one decimal place (even if the decimal is 0). chrysalis center mn

c - storing negative numbers - Stack Overflow

Category:How negative number stored is represented in Binary : C

Tags:How to store negative numbers in c

How to store negative numbers in c

Numeric Data Types - Visual Basic Microsoft Learn

WebJul 20, 2024 · 1 Sometimes we need to format Numbers with Positive (+) and Negative (-) signs which we can achieve easily using string formatting. Given below is string format which has three parts separated by a semicolon, the first is for positive numbers, the second is for negative numbers and the third is for zero. private static double posNumber = … Webint GetNonNegativeInteger () { int input; cin >> input; while (input < 0) { } return input; } Change the red code to this: cout << "Negative number not allowed." << endl; cin >> input; Which is what you have in your code, just slightly different each time, which is correct.

How to store negative numbers in c

Did you know?

Web/* C Program to Put Positive and Negative Numbers in two Separate Arrays */ #include void PrintArray (int a [], int Size); int main () { int Size, i, a [10], Positive [10], Negative [10]; int … WebFeb 17, 2024 · Method 4: Using Bitset of C++ We can use the bitset class of C++ to store the binary representation of any number (positive as well as a negative number). It offers us the flexibility to have the number of bits of our desire, like whether we want to have 32-bit binary representation of just an 8-bit representation of a number.

Websigned number is represented in binary using 2's complement. This video will show proof for it. WebJul 25, 2024 · Explanation: First of all, it should be understood that negative numbers are stored in the 2’s complement form of their positive counterpart. The compiler converts …

WebMar 24, 2024 · If a negative number is encountered, its bit representation is calculated. After that, the bits are flipped, and 1 is added to them. Let us see an example. Number: -6 Sign: … WebAug 8, 2024 · Approach: Store all the non-negative elements of the array in another vector and sort this vector. Now, replace all the non-negative values in the original array with these sorted values. Below is the implementation of the above approach: C++ Java Python3 C# Javascript #include using namespace std; void sortArray (int a [], int n) {

WebAug 14, 2024 · That two’s complement is kept at place allocated in memory and the sign bit will be set to 1 because the binary being kept is of a negative number. Whenever it comes …

WebNov 3, 2024 · In order to find the negative binary representation a number n, you will need to flip all of the bits (in C, you can use the negation operator '~' to do this) and add 1. derrick henry nfl career rushing yardsWebNegative numbers can be assigned to char variables. To assign negative numbers “signed” type qualifier is used. I believe most compilers use signed char by default. To retrieve the negative number assigned a simple printf statement with integer format specifier (%d) will suffice. Example : signed char a = -46; printf (“%d”,a); // prints: -46 chrysalis center orlandoWebMar 14, 2016 · How negative number stored is represented in Binary : C++ Programming HowTo 70.9K subscribers Subscribe 43 Share Save 5.9K views 7 years ago C++ Programming signed number is … chrysalis center phoenixWebThe simple way to understand this is: For positive number we know that number is converted into binary and then stored in the memory. For storing negative numbers: Forget the sign … derrick henry playoff statsWebWrite function called split () to read array and put all + #s in "positive" array and - #s into "negative" array Call a function to display values in both positive & negative arrays Extend program to sort positive & negative arrays in ascending order before they are displayed I created the major array with 20 values and put the numbers in there. derrick henry receiving yardsWebIn this video we will learn1. Example programs on signed and unsigend type modifiers - 00:48 2. How negative values get stored in variables memory space - 02... chrysalis center minneapolis mnWeb0:00 / 5:12 Check for Positive or Negative Number or Zero C++ Example Program Example Program 24K subscribers 330 25K views 2 years ago C++ Example Programs for Beginners In this C++... derrick henry receiving